Bird vs Cage ... spoiler I guess
So does anything change at all if you picked either of them? I totally forgot about the bird and cage and didn't even think about the symbolism of the two while picking the cage, but yeah does anything change at all through the game?

Suzaku Apr 8, 2013 @ 8:51pm 
It might change one completely inconsequential graphical thing in a single brief sequence for a few seconds, but that could have been a trick of the light. I was not able to confirm it when I chose the other option.

But no, it really doesn't change anything of note.

Oh, I suppose the dialogue immediately following your initial choice is different. "I thought he'd choose the ______" there the blank is filled in by the thing you didn't choose.

Caelinus Apr 8, 2013 @ 9:25pm 
Yeah, the choice just hammering down the variables and constants theme.
SPOILER One of the theories for that is that it is a "test" for the Luttece to know if anything is happenning differently compared to the previous revolution of the story. If Booker dies and come back there and make the same choice, the "twins" will know if it is the correct thing to have so that they can confirm all the previous events.

Amycus Apr 9, 2013 @ 12:09am 
I heavily suspect that it was intended to be used in the end of the game. Be warned that that the following can be considered as a spoiler:

At the end scene, when you turn around to see Elizabeth, Booker says "wait... you are not her", and she is at this time missing the jewelry she was just wearing right before she entered the room. She is wearing neither the bird or the cage at this one time. I'm fairly certain that they originally intended to change this jewelry depending on whether you picked the bird or the cage, but later removed it completely for time restraints or something.
